About the role

The Infrastructure Manager is responsible for overseeing the maintenance repair and compliance of community infrastructure within a gated Property Owners Association (POA). This role ensures the effective management of stormwater drainage systems roadways and structural components while also reviewing new construction to confirm adherence to established drainage policies and community standards.

  • Manage and maintain stormwater drainage systems including inspections and preventative maintenance

  • Plan and oversee road repaving projects and concrete repairs (slabs curbs etc.)

  • Conduct inspections of new construction to ensure compliance with drainage and infrastructure requirements

  • Coordinate and manage vendors contractors and service providers

  • Develop and manage infrastructure budgets including forecasting and cost control

  • Serve as a primary point of contact for homeowners regarding infrastructure concerns

  • Professionally resolve homeowner complaints and conflicts in a calm solution-oriented manner

  • Maintain accurate documentation reports and project tracking using Microsoft Office

  • Ensure all work complies with POA standards safety requirements and applicable regulations
